A Federal Decree establishing the International Humanitarian and Philanthropic Council is issued by the UAE President.

Sheikh Mohamed Bin Zayed Al Nahyan issued the President, His Excellency, A Federal Decree creating the International Humanitarian and Philanthropic Council.

The council oversees worldwide humanitarian and philanthropic activities. It is led by His Highness Sheikh Theyab Bin Mohamed Bin Zayed Al Nahyan, Chairman of the Office of Development and Martyrs Families activities at the Presidential Court.

Additionally, the council is made up of the following individuals: His Excellency Faris Mohammed Ahmed Al Mazrouei, Advisor to the Presidential Court; His Excellency Dr. Hamdan Musallam Al Mazrouei, Chairman of the Board of Directors of the Emirates Red Crescent; His Excellency Mohammed Saif Al Suwaidi, Director-General of the Abu Dhabi Fund for Development; and His Excellency Sultan Mohammed Al Shamsi, Assistant Minister of Foreign Affairs and International Cooperation for International Development Affairs.
